His first year as captain failed to reach the heights of 2010 when he won his second club best and fairest. An Achilles injury at the start of the season was partly due to that and reduced his output in the early games. However, by the middle of the season, he was back to his tough and skilful best. Hodge was again the ‘Mr Fixit’ for the Hawks, spending time in the middle, in defence and as a spare parts forward. Averaged 25.3 disposals a game and, incredibly, his 17 Brownlow votes was a personal best.

Draft history: 2001 National AFL Draft priority selection (Hawthorn) No. 1 overall traded by Fremantle for Trent Croad and Luke McPharlin.

  • Debut: AFL 2002
  • Recruited from: Colac/Geelong U18
  • AFL Awards: Norm Smith Medal 2008; All-Australian 2005, 2008; International Rules Series 2005; NAB AFL Rising Star nominee 2002; premiership side 2008
  • Club Awards: best and fairest 2005; 2nd best and fairest 2006; 3rd best and fairest 2007, 2008; captain 2011
